Transaction 8799e925598ceaa9021689eabfe2968224901555e7c82e9a08dfa223a209ab44

2 Input
2 Outputs
  • 8799e925598ceaa9021689eabfe2968224901555e7c82e9a08dfa223a209ab44:0
  • value  400000000
    address  19QC1xtCsSL3ySzZ4wybx4BwQhU8MomXcq
  • 8799e925598ceaa9021689eabfe2968224901555e7c82e9a08dfa223a209ab44:1
  • value  36432762
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K